Sam Goodman (March 19, 1931 - August 5, 1991) was an American Southern gospel singer/songwriter born in Bremen, Alabama. Charles F. Goodman (September 2, 1933 November 11, 1990) better known as Rusty Goodman was a singer/Songwriter in the Southern Gospel Music industry that wrote some of histories most prolific songs; such as Standing in the Presence of the King, Leavin On My Mind, Home, John the Revelator, Standing in the Need of Prayer, Had it Not Been I Believe Hes Coming Back Look for Me and Who Am I? His songs have been covered by many of the top artists in the music industry including Elvis Presley, The Imperials, JD Sumner & The Stamps, The Speers, The Happy Goodman Family, Michael English and Gaither Vocal Band. .
